Radio host says Caitlin Clark is WNBA's version of Jeremy Lin: 'The exact same thing'
- A Fox News article reports Tyrone Johnson comparing Caitlin Clark’s rising fame to Jeremy Lin’s Linsanity, suggesting her popularity may fade.
- The piece argues Clark’s status as a top rookie and global figure could wane if she isn’t the best player in the league or in her class.
- The article links Lin’s 2012 Knicks run to Clark’s ascent, noting Lin’s high-scoring stretch and subsequent career path.
- Clark’s rookie season is described as record-setting, with high expectations and notable achievements.
- The piece mentions mixed reactions from fans and analysts regarding the Lin-Clark comparison.
- The article cites Lin’s own career trajectory as context for the debate about Clark’s longevity.
- The report situates Caitlin Clark’s emergence within the broader growth of women’s basketball.
